A gunfight between holed up militants and security forces began on Wednesday in Jammu and Kashmir's Badgam district, police said.
Following specific information about militant presence in Kuthpora village, a cordon and search operation was launched.
As the security forces were closing in on the hiding terrorists, they fired starting the encounter, a police officer said.
Authorities have suspended mobile Internet in Badgam and Pulwama districts.
